This beautifully presented traditional four bedroom semi-detached family house is situated in a convenient location. Walking distance to the local shops, schools, promenade & beach. A short drive to Colwyn Bay & Rhos on Sea. Retaining many original features including high ceilings and picture rails but with a spacious layout with the added bonus of a large loft room. Comprising of:- Entrance porch, hallway with solid oak flooring through to the lounge & dining room, lounge with bay window and feature fireplace, dining room with French doors out to the garden, Oak kitchen/diner with door to the side of the property, utility room and cloakroom. Stairs lead from the hallway to the first floor where there are four double bedrooms, one with bay window, family bathroom with separate shower. There is a great feature on this floor of a “laundry shoot” down into the utility room. More stairs lead to the large loft room with extra storage. This area is currently used as an office but has the potential for a “master suite” The front of the property is set behind stone walls with substantial off-road parking on the driveway and access to the rear garden via timber gate. The enclosed rear garden is stunning. South facing and landscaped with an abundance of well established trees, plants & shrubs. Patio seating area for outside dining and entertaining, summer house and garden store. Benefitting from gas central heating and UPVC double glazing throughout.
